Publix opens appointments for Moderna’s COVID-19 vaccine: Here’s how to book online

Publix is opening online appointments for Modera’s COVID-19 vaccine Friday morning.

The pharmacy is allowing Floridians to make an appointment online starting at 7 a.m.

Those who make an online appointment Friday will receive their dose of the vaccine on Monday or Tuesday.

Here’s who can make an appointment:

  • Long-term care facility residents and staff
  • People aged 50 years and older
  • People deemed extremely vulnerable
  • Health care personnel with direct patient contact
  • K-12 school employees
  • Sworn law enforcement officers aged 50 years and older
  • Firefighters aged 50 years and older

Publix is not allowing residents to make an appointment by phone — they must make an appointment online.

Publix will give Floridians another chance to make an appointment for the Moderna COVID-19 vaccine on Monday.
